Core Concepts: The Brain-Gut Axis and the Gut Microbiome

The brain-gut axis explained

The brain-gut axis comprises complex communication pathways that involve the nervous system, hormones, and immune signals. This ongoing dialogue between the gastrointestinal tract and the brain influences various functions, including stress responses and emotional regulation.

The gut microbiome

The gut microbiome refers to the diverse community of microorganisms residing in our digestive tracts. Its diversity and balance are critical for overall health. Dysbiosis, or microbial imbalance, can occur due to factors like poor diet, stress, and antibiotics, which can subsequently affect both gut and brain health.

Symptoms as signals

Mood changes, digestive issues, and alterations in sleep patterns are often reflections of underlying brain-gut interactions. Changes in gut health can manifest as psychological symptoms, and vice versa, offering vital signals regarding an individual’s overall well-being.

The Role of the Gut Microbiome in This Topic

How microbes influence brain function

Microbes in the gut produce various signaling molecules that can influence brain function, including neurotransmitters and other metabolites. These interactions form part of the broader communication system within the body.

Key mechanisms

Notable mechanisms through which the gut microbiome affects mental health include the production of short-chain fatty acids (SCFAs), involvement in tryptophan metabolism (a precursor for serotonin), and modulation of immune responses.

Microbiome diversity, resilience, and vulnerability

Microbiome diversity is linked to resilience, while a lack of diversity can predispose individuals to both physical and psychological vulnerabilities. Understanding this aspect of microbiome health is crucial for personalized interventions.

Q&A Section

1. How does the gut microbiome affect mental health?

The gut microbiome influences mental health through various mechanisms, including the production of neurotransmitters and signaling molecules, metabolic byproducts, and immune modulation. These factors can affect mood, anxiety levels, and overall psychological resilience.

2. What are the signs of gut health problems?

Signs of gut health problems can include digestive issues (like bloating or irregular bowel habits), mood swings, fatigue, sleep disturbances, and inflammatory responses. These symptoms may indicate underlying dysbiosis or an imbalance in the gut microbiome.

3. Can dietary changes improve both gut and mental health?

Yes, dietary changes can significantly impact both gut and mental health. Consuming a diverse, nutrient-rich diet with fiber, fermented foods, and healthy fats can improve microbiome diversity and contribute to better mood and cognitive function.

4. What is dysbiosis?

Dysbiosis refers to an imbalance in the microbial communities of the gut, often resulting in an overgrowth of harmful bacteria or a decrease in beneficial ones. This condition can lead to various health issues, including gastrointestinal disorders and mental health problems.

7. What role does stress play in gut health?

Stress can significantly impact gut health by altering gut permeability and microbiome composition. Chronic stress can lead to dysbiosis, exacerbating gastrointestinal symptoms and negatively affecting mental well-being.

10. Can probiotics help with mental health?

Research suggests that probiotics may benefit mental health by improving gut microbiome composition and function. However, individual responses vary, and probiotics should be used as part of a broader strategy for mental and gut health.

11. Are there specific foods that support gut health?

Foods such as fruits, vegetables, whole grains, legumes, as well as fermented foods like yogurt and kimchi, are known to promote gut health. These foods provide fiber and microorganisms that support a healthy microbiome.
